Output 95fa8009d6acd06151cf504c74441f8cf004b25ae838510d51ef6037165fbf0c:0

value
22557929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d4d1ff854b4dab7cc87b335e1913d11fb28a91b OP_EQUAL
address
3QnMGooEdgZgjeX6uTWswCLgVgGMLMYps6
transaction
95fa8009d6acd06151cf504c74441f8cf004b25ae838510d51ef6037165fbf0c
spent
true